About This Job: Accountant

Examine, analyze, and interpret accounting records to prepare financial statements, give advice, or audit and evaluate statements prepared by others. Install or advise on systems of recording costs or other financial and budgetary data.

Salary Range: Accountant in Minnesota

Salaries for Accountant in Minnesota range from $54,840 at the 10th percentile (entry level) to $135,370 at the 90th percentile (experienced). The middle 50% earn between $64,790 and $102,940.

Percentile Annual Salary Hourly Rate Monthly
10th Percentile (Entry Level) $54,840 $26.37 $4,570
25th Percentile $64,790 $31.15 $5,399
Median (50th) $81,100 $38.99 $6,758
75th Percentile $102,940 $49.49 $8,578
90th Percentile (Experienced) $135,370 $65.08 $11,280

Note: The mean (average) salary of $92,240 differs from the median because salary distributions are typically skewed by high earners.

Data Source & Methodology

Salary data is sourced from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) survey, 2024 estimates. The OEWS survey covers approximately 1.1 million establishments nationwide.

Annual salaries are calculated based on a standard 2,080-hour work year. Actual compensation may vary based on experience, education, employer, and local market conditions. Figures do not include benefits, bonuses, or overtime pay.
